This book highlights the design of an educational module for an innovative intensive program. The theme is very relevant in the contemporary approach to teaching activities. In fact thanks to the didactic design it is possible to obtain a strong relationship between teachers and learners as required by the Bologna Process. It also allows a stronger definition of learning outcomes.After a general excursus on the subject the manuscript refers to a recent experience carried out in the Aeolian Island for the Erasmus + Programme called VVITA. In it an international group of students and teachers spent a period in the Aeolian Islands to focus on the features of local vernacular architecture. The attention has been addressed to the Aeolian House which is a wonderful example of ante litteram sustainable architecture. On the island of Filicudi one of the most beautiful of the archipelago it has preserved its characteristics intact.The book is completed by teachers lectures and students final reports.
